There is no such thing as a single national Subway price list, and anyone publishing one as gospel is guessing. Roughly 99% of US Subway restaurants are owned by independent franchisees, and each of them sets menu prices for their own store based on rent, wages and local competition. What we can do — and what this page does — is give you honest ranges collected across urban, suburban and rural locations in 2026, so you know whether the number on your receipt is normal or steep.

Two quick rules of thumb before the tables. First, a Footlong almost always costs less per inch than two 6-inch subs, so if two people are eating, split a Footlong. Second, the app is frequently cheaper than the counter for the same order, because digital-only offers and MVP Rewards points only apply to app and web orders.

Wraps, bowls and salads

Wraps and No Bready Bowls are built with roughly Footlong quantities of filling, which is why they are priced near Footlong level rather than 6-inch level. Expect $11.49 to $16.99 for a wrap, $12.99 to $17.49 for a No Bready Bowl and $9.49 to $13.49 for a chopped salad. Gram for gram, the bowl is the most protein you can buy at Subway for under twenty dollars.

Why your Subway is more expensive than the one across town

Five factors explain nearly every price gap readers write to us about:

  • Franchise pricing freedom. Each owner sets their own board prices. Two stores four miles apart can differ by $2 on the same Footlong.
  • Captive locations. Airports, hospitals, campuses, stadiums and turnpike plazas routinely run 15–35% above street prices, and many do not accept national coupons.
  • Local wage and rent costs. Coastal metros price meaningfully higher than the Midwest and South.
  • Delivery markups. Prices inside third-party delivery apps are usually inflated before fees are even added. Ordering pickup in the Subway app is materially cheaper.
  • Promo participation. Value platforms like Sub of the Day are optional for franchisees, so a nearby store may honour a deal yours does not.

How to pay less without ordering less

  1. Order in the Subway app and stack MVP Rewards points against a future free Footlong.
  2. Use the Sub of the Day or Meal of the Day — the single biggest lever on this list.
  3. Buy a Footlong and take half home rather than buying a 6-inch today and another tomorrow.
  4. Skip premium add-ons like double meat and avocado, which can add 30% to the ticket, and load up on free vegetables instead.
  5. For groups, price a platter against individual subs — platters usually win above five people.
